The program's topic is "

Press", part 2. The problems of the Russian press, raised by the host Yuli Gusmanov, attracted the attention of the editors-in-chief of the newspapers "

Izvestia", "

Komsomolskaya Pravda"

and "

Pravda": Igor Golembiovsky, Valery Simonov and Alexander Ilyin, the chairman of the Glasnost Foundation Alexei Simonov, the editor-in-chief of the newspaper "

Novoe Russkoe Slovo"

Grigory Vainer, the founder and owner of numerous tabloid publications Evgeny Dodolev, the editor-in-chief of the new youth magazine "

OM"

Igor Grigoriev, representatives of the provincial press from Rostov-on-Don and Yaroslavl.

The ensuing discussion was also attended by the dean of the journalism faculty of Moscow State University Yasen Zasursky, the notorious journalist Otar Kushanashvili, the editor-in-chief of the magazine "Itogi" Sergei Parkhomenko and young Russian journalists.
